Easy Funeral Potatoes Recipe with Frozen Hash Browns

These are the cheesiest funeral potatoes you'll ever make with the best crispy, crunchy topping. Not only are they incredibly easy to make, but they are pure comfort food!

Ingredients

  • 32 ounces frozen cubed potatoes (hashbrowns), thawed
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 14.5 ounce can cream of chicken soup
  • 8 ounces sour cream
  • 8 ounces sharp cheddar cheese shredded
  • salt & pepper to taste
  • 4 tablespoons butter melted
  • 3 cups crushed corn flakes

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350ºF.
  2. Add the hash browns, onion powder, garlic powder, cream of chicken soup, sour cream, cheddar, salt, and pepper to a large mixing bowl. Mix until it's fully combined.
  3. Pour the potato mixture into a 9x13 baking dish.
  4. To a small mixing bowl, add the butter and cornflakes. Mix until the butter coats the cornflakes.
  5. Sprinkle the cornflakes evenly over the potato mixture.
  6. Bake in the oven for about 1 hour and 15 minutes. You want it hot and bubbly and the topping browned.

Notes

  • Be sure that the potatoes are fully thawed. If they aren't thawed, it will add water to the casserole and make it watery.
